I believe airplane and company must be US registered.
In Africa (every country I know of there) you have to convert your CPL to that country's CPL, unless it's a US company with a US plane.
In the UK, your FAA CPL (or PPL) is good as a PPL, but to get paid you have to have a JAA CPL or be flying for a US company in a US plane.
